通过使用套接字来达到进程间通信目的编程就是网络编程。windows提供的基于网络编程的就是套接字也就是winsock,但是现在Winpcap也是一个比较方便的工具。开发语言不限啊。C、java、vb都可以。目前通用的编程语言有两种形式:汇编语言和高级语言。汇编语言的实质和机器语言是相同的,都是直接对硬件操作,只不过指令采用了英文缩写的标识符,更容易识别和记忆。它同样需要编程者将每一步具体的操作用命令的形式写出来。汇编程序通常由三部分组成:指令、伪指令和宏指令。
网络编程最基础最简单的是HTML语言,你可以上网下一些资料,先学HTML,等你基本掌握一些最常用的HTML代码后,可以借助dreamweaver等网页制作软件,不用自己手敲代码就能轻松设计一些简单的网页,接着,你可以学CSS,利用CSS可以实现很多功能,比如一些网页中字体、标题的样式设定。建议报一个培训班,都是零基础入学的,这是网络编程的全部课程,要是感兴趣的话可以了解一下:第一阶段,计算机操作基础,Office办公自动化,计算机组装与维护,C语言第二阶段,SQLServer,据库设计,和高级查询,数据结构,C#面向对象程序设计,HTML,CSS,发。
网络编程主要是针对网页上的应用程序来编写的一些嵌入式程序。比如说JSP动态网页,就是在网页中结合了JAVA的APPLET编程技术的网页。主要应用语言为JAVA。系统编程就是针对系统的一些开发,比如管理一个图书馆的系统等等,系统编程需要结合数据库和数据结构的相关算法来实现程序的效果。比如C 语言。定义通过使用套接字来达到进程间通信目的编程就是网络编程。windows提供的基于网络编程的就是套接字也就是winsock,但是现在Winpcap也是一个比较方便的工具。网络编程从大的方面说就是对信息的发送到接收,中间传输为物理线路的作用,编程人员可以不用考虑…。
Python网络编程
网络编程和电子邮件,网络编程主要是TCP和UDP的编程,示例见【Python网络编程】利用Python进行TCP、UDP套接字编程,SMTP是发送邮件的协议,Python内置对SMTP的支持,可以发送纯文本邮件、HTML邮件以及带附件的邮件。Python对SMTP支持有smtplib和email两个模块,email负责构造邮件,smtplib负责发送邮件。通过这些课程的学习,学员可以掌握Python编程的基本知识和技能,为后续的学习打下坚实的基础。Python进阶开发课程在Python基础开发课程的基础上,进阶开发课程主要包括面向对象编程、设计模式、异常处理、多线程、多进程、网络编程等知识点。通过这些课程的学习。
掌握Python中常用的数据结构,如列表、字典、集合等,并学习常见的算法。Web开发了解Python在Web开发中的应用,学习使用Web框架如Django、Flask等搭建网站。数据处理和分析学习Python在数据处理和分析领域的应用,如NumPy、Pandas等库的使用。网络编程了解Python的网络编程功能。Python可以做什么?网站后端程序员:使用它单间网站,后台服务比较容易维护。如:Gmail、Youtube、知乎、豆瓣,自动化运维:自动化处理大量的运维任务,数据分析师:快速开发快速验证,分析数据得到结果,游戏开发者:一般是作为游戏脚本内嵌在游戏中,自动化测试:编写为简单的实现脚本。
数据库编程:程序员可通过遵循PythonDB-API(数据库应用程序编程接口)规范的模块与MicrosoftSQLServer,Oracle,Sybase,DB,MySQL、SQLite等数据库通信。python自带有一个Gadfly模块,提供了一个完整的SQL环境。网络编程:提供丰富的模块支持sockets编程,能方便快速地开发分布式应用程序。概括起来,Python的应用领域主要有如下几个。科学计算NumPy、SciPy、Matplotlib可以让Python程序员编写科学计算程序。以上都只是Python应用领域的冰山一角,总的来说,Python语言不仅可以应用到网络编程、游戏开发等领域,还可以在图形图像处理、只能机器人、爬取数据、自动化运维等多方面展露头角。
《EffectivePython》:介绍高效编码方式,包括内存节省、属性管理等,适合经验丰富的开发者。《Python网络编程攻略》:实战指南,讲解Socket编程、HTTP、SMTP,适合网络编程爱好者。《利用Python进行数据分析》:讲解数据处理工具,如NumPy、Pandas,适合数据分析人员。《Python基础教程》:入门教材,内容易懂。强大使用的网络编程语言是什么?还能写软件我用php语言想学高级点的能写软件能写网页的好的语言推荐给我拜托~我用php语言想学高级点的能写软件能写网页的好的语言推荐给我拜托~展开我来答,回答#热议#妇女节专题:女性如何自我保护?rumence。
神经网络编程
根据神经网络输出的预测结果,在PLC逻辑中实现相应的控制动作。通过在外部软件中重新训练网络,并将更新的模型导入到PLC中,实现神经网络模型的迭代升级。也可以直接在PLC中通过函数块实现神经网络算法,但比较复杂。总体来说,采用混合编程模式,在外部软件训练网络。当时,落水者不会游泳,在河中一直挣扎大声呼救,情形十分紧迫。天津大学,非洲留学生,来自安哥拉的约瑟、茂罗、米格尔以及来自佛得角的帕特里克,正巧途经此地。米格尔跟帕特里克顾不上脱下鞋子,纵身跳进河里救人。两人先是协力将一名落水者托起,游到岸边。在河岸上的两位错误把落水者拉上了岸。
一般在编程时,设置一个矩阵为bounds=ones(S,*[-;%权值上下界。在MATLAB中,可以直接使用net=init(net);来初始化。matlab中epochs是什么意思横坐标:训练结束时的epochs数【神经网络一次前向传播 一次反向传播=一个epoch】纵坐标:均方误差从图中可以得到:在epochs=,。基于MATLAB的神经网络编程(编程理论作为比较成熟的算法,软件Matlab中有神经网络工具箱,所以可以借助Matlab神经网络工具箱的强大功能,在此基础上进行二次开发,从繁琐的编程工作中解脱出来,大大提高工作效率。Matlab的神经网络工具箱是在Matlab环境下所开发出来的许多工具箱之一。
不是说把W改成B就可以,而是在调节权值的时候就会不断更新阈值(阀值是错别字)因此阈值只会出现,预设,实际输出值与期望值之间的误差可以导致新一轮的权值修正。正向传播与反向传播过程循环往复,直到网络收敛,得到网络收敛后的互联权值和阈值。一般在编程时。神经网络模型?不会是你的课题吧,大型算法应用(有界面),当然用C (效率高)来写,JAVA次之(略简单)。学习算法的精髓就用C,C 和JAVA作为高级语言打包了很多基础型的算法。
暂无评论内容